The thesis will be an integral part of the SDU Climate Elite Centre project “Mobilizing Post-Anthropocentric Climate Action: A New Root Narrative” (PACA). PACA seeks to map post-anthropocentric social theories that challenge the nature-culture divide and investigate traces of these theories in the population. It assesses the extent to which such practices and beliefs can provide a positive narrative for a new organization of production and consumption practices and, finally, the role of universities as mediators of the emergent post-anthropocentrism. This project has the ambition to develop into an international hub for research in post-anthropocentric consumption and production systems as foundational for a sustainable economy.

The PhD will contribute to surveying post-anthropocentrism(s) as part of the project’s overall development of a post-anthropocentric ontology in social movements, communities, and industries. PACA is based on the hypothesis that a conceptual shift in Social Sciences towards a post-anthropocentric narrative(s) can provide the imaginative basis for a different economy with different modes of production and consumption and to mobilize what has been termed the emergent ecological class (Latour and Schultz 2022). The workload will be geared towards researching.

  • the terrain and post-anthropocentric narrative(s) of dominant actors in the consumption and production-related social movements, communities, and industries as well as
  • systemic intermediary strategies for universities to promote an effective post-anthropocentric narrative in society.

While both elements are central to the project, the main focus of this PhD position is on the post-anthropocentric narratives and alternative economic production and consumption models.
